Wacky Cake

Easy wacky cake recipe that's made with no eggs and no dairy.

Ingredients

  • 1 ½ cups all-purpose flour
  • 1 cup granulated sugar
  • 5 tablespoons Dutch process cocoa powder
  • 1 teaspoon baking soda
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• 2 teaspoons vanilla extract
  • 1 teaspoon white vinegar
  • 6 tablespoons vegetable oil
  • 1 cup hot water not boiling

Instructions

  1. Preheat 350 degrees F.
  2. Place the dry ingredients (flour, sugar, cocoa powder, baking soda, and salt) in a bowl.
  3. Make 3 small holes in the mixture.
  4. Pour the vanilla in one hole, the vinegar in another and vegetable oil in another.
  5. Pour water over the top, and whisk to combine. 
  6. Pour into a lightly greased 8x8-inch metal baking pan. 
  7. Bake for 30-35 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ted in the center comes out clean.
  8. Let cool in pan. 

Notes

  • Cocoa powder: Or an equal amount of unsweetened cocoa powder
  • Oil: Can use a different type of oil. I also like melted coconut oil.
  • Water: I use hot tap water. No need to heat it beyond that.
